# S3 Binary Share — Eliminate Docker Builds, Faster Pod Startup **Date**: 2026-02-28 **Status**: Approved ## Problem Every code change triggers a long pipeline: compile → Kaniko packages 9 images → push to registry → pods pull images. The training image alone is ~3GB (CUDA runtime). Even with an image-prepuller DaemonSet, rebuilding and pushing images adds 3-7 minutes per pipeline. During active trading, a pod crash + image pull could cause unacceptable downtime. ## Solution Replace per-service Docker images with generic base images + S3-based binary distribution. CI compiles and uploads stripped binaries to S3. Pods run generic base images (pre-pulled, rarely change) and fetch binaries from S3 via initContainer on startup. A PVC cache per service provides fallback if S3 is unavailable during trading. ## Architecture ### S3 Bucket Structure ``` s3://foxhunt-binaries/ ├── latest/ │ ├── services/ │ │ ├── trading_service │ │ ├── api_gateway │ │ ├── broker_gateway_service │ │ ├── ml_training_service │ │ ├── backtesting_service │ │ ├── trading_agent_service │ │ ├── data_acquisition_service │ │ └── web-gateway │ ├── training/ │ │ ├── train_baseline_rl │ │ ├── train_baseline_supervised │ │ ├── evaluate_baseline │ │ ├── evaluate_supervised │ │ ├── hyperopt_baseline_rl │ │ ├── hyperopt_baseline_supervised │ │ └── training_uploader │ ├── web-dashboard/ │ │ └── dist/ # Vite build output │ └── MANIFEST.json # {sha, timestamp} └── archive// # optional audit trail ``` - Compile always overwrites `latest/` - Optional: copy to `archive//` for debugging - Pods always fetch from `latest/` - Lifecycle rule: delete archive entries older than 30 days - Bucket region: fr-par (same as cluster) ### Generic Base Images (3 total) All pushed to `rg.fr-par.scw.cloud/foxhunt-ci/` (Scaleway Container Registry). #### 1. foxhunt-runtime (services) ```dockerfile FROM debian:bookworm-slim RUN apt-get update && apt-get install -y --no-install-recommends \ ca-certificates libssl3 curl unzip \ && curl -fsSL https://downloads.rclone.org/v1.69.1/rclone-v1.69.1-linux-amd64.zip -o /tmp/rclone.zip \ && unzip -j /tmp/rclone.zip '*/rclone' -d /usr/local/bin/ \ && rm /tmp/rclone.zip \ && apt-get purge -y unzip && rm -rf /var/lib/apt/lists/* RUN curl -fsSL https://github.com/grpc-ecosystem/grpc-health-probe/releases/download/v0.4.25/grpc_health_probe-linux-amd64 \ -o /usr/local/bin/grpc_health_probe && chmod +x /usr/local/bin/grpc_health_probe RUN groupadd -g 1000 foxhunt && useradd -u 1000 -g foxhunt -m -s /bin/false foxhunt USER foxhunt ``` Size: ~100MB. Rebuild: only when libssl/rclone/grpc_health_probe updates. #### 2. foxhunt-training-runtime (GPU training) ```dockerfile FROM nvidia/cuda:12.4.1-cudnn-runtime-ubuntu22.04 ENV DEBIAN_FRONTEND=noninteractive RUN apt-get update && apt-get install -y --no-install-recommends \ ca-certificates libssl3 curl unzip cuda-nvrtc-12-4 \ && curl -fsSL https://downloads.rclone.org/v1.69.1/rclone-v1.69.1-linux-amd64.zip -o /tmp/rclone.zip \ && unzip -j /tmp/rclone.zip '*/rclone' -d /usr/local/bin/ \ && rm /tmp/rclone.zip \ && apt-get purge -y unzip && rm -rf /var/lib/apt/lists/* RUN groupadd -g 1000 foxhunt && useradd -u 1000 -g foxhunt -m -s /bin/false foxhunt ENV NVIDIA_VISIBLE_DEVICES=all ENV NVIDIA_DRIVER_CAPABILITIES=compute,utility USER foxhunt ``` Size: ~3GB (CUDA dominates). Rebuild: only on CUDA version bump. Image-prepuller DaemonSet still caches this on GPU nodes. #### 3. foxhunt-node-builder (Vite build CI job) ```dockerfile FROM node:22-slim RUN apt-get update && apt-get install -y --no-install-recommends \ curl unzip \ && curl -fsSL https://downloads.rclone.org/v1.69.1/rclone-v1.69.1-linux-amd64.zip -o /tmp/rclone.zip \ && unzip -j /tmp/rclone.zip '*/rclone' -d /usr/local/bin/ \ && rm /tmp/rclone.zip \ && apt-get purge -y unzip && rm -rf /var/lib/apt/lists/* ``` Size: ~200MB. Rebuild: only on Node major version bump. ### CI Pipeline Changes #### New pipeline flow ``` prepare → test → compile → deploy ``` Build stage is entirely eliminated. #### compile-services (modified) Same cargo build, but uploads to S3 instead of creating GitLab artifacts: ```yaml compile-services: extends: .rust-base-cpu stage: compile needs: [] script: - mkdir -p "$SCCACHE_DIR" && sccache --zero-stats || true - PROFILE=${DEV_RELEASE:+dev-release}; do kubectl -n foxhunt rollout status deployment/$svc --timeout=120s done ``` #### Deleted CI jobs - `.kaniko-service-base` template - `.kaniko-training-base` template - `build-trading-service`, `build-api-gateway`, `build-broker-gateway` - `build-ml-training`, `build-backtesting`, `build-trading-agent` - `build-data-acquisition`, `build-web-gateway`, `build-training` - `artifacts:` sections in compile jobs ### Deployment Pattern Every service deployment uses this initContainer pattern: ```yaml initContainers: - name: fetch-binary image: rg.fr-par.scw.cloud/foxhunt-ci/foxhunt-runtime:latest command: ["/bin/sh", "-c"] args: - | set -e SERVICE=trading_service if rclone copyto s3:foxhunt-binaries/latest/services/$SERVICE /binaries/$SERVICE 2>/dev/null; then chmod +x /binaries/$SERVICE cp /binaries/$SERVICE /cache/$SERVICE echo "Fetched from S3 ($(stat -c%s /binaries/$SERVICE) bytes)" elif [ -f /cache/$SERVICE ]; then cp /cache/$SERVICE /binaries/$SERVICE chmod +x /binaries/$SERVICE echo "WARNING: S3 unavailable, using cached binary" else echo "FATAL: No binary available (S3 down + empty cache)" exit 1 fi env: - name: RCLONE_S3_PROVIDER value: Scaleway - name: RCLONE_S3_ENDPOINT value: s3.fr-par.scw.cloud - name: RCLONE_S3_REGION value: fr-par - name: RCLONE_S3_ACCESS_KEY_ID valueFrom: secretKeyRef: name: s3-credentials key: access-key - name: RCLONE_S3_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Y valueFrom: secretKeyRef: name: s3-credentials key: secret-key volumeMounts: - name: binaries mountPath: /binaries - name: binary-cache mountPath: /cache resources: requests: cpu: 100m memory: 64Mi limits: cpu: 500m memory: 128Mi containers: - name: trading-service image: rg.fr-par.scw.cloud/foxhunt-ci/foxhunt-runtime:latest command: ["/binaries/trading_service"] volumeMounts: - name: binaries mountPath: /binaries readOnly: true volumes: - name: binaries emptyDir: sizeLimit: 200Mi - name: binary-cache persistentVolumeClaim: claimName: binary-cache-trading-service ``` #### web-gateway special case initContainer fetches both binary and dashboard assets: ```yaml args: - | set -e SERVICE=web-gateway if rclone copyto s3:foxhunt-binaries/latest/services/$SERVICE /binaries/$SERVICE 2>/dev/null; then chmod +x /binaries/$SERVICE cp /binaries/$SERVICE /cache/$SERVICE rclone sync s3:foxhunt-binaries/latest/web-dashboard/dist/ /binaries/static/ cp -r /binaries/static /cache/static echo "Fetched from S3" elif [ -f /cache/$SERVICE ]; then cp /cache/$SERVICE /binaries/$SERVICE chmod +x /binaries/$SERVICE cp -r /cache/static /binaries/static 2>/dev/null || true echo "WARNING: S3 unavailable, using cached binary" else echo "FATAL: No binary available" exit 1 fi ``` #### Training job template Uses `foxhunt-training-runtime`, no cache PVC (batch jobs can retry): ```yaml initContainers: - name: fetch-binaries image: rg.fr-par.scw.cloud/foxhunt-ci/foxhunt-training-runtime:latest command: ["/bin/sh", "-c"] args: - | set -e rclone sync s3:foxhunt-binaries/latest/training/ /binaries/ chmod +x /binaries/* echo "Fetched training binaries" volumeMounts: - name: binaries mountPath: /binaries containers: - name: training image: rg.fr-par.scw.cloud/foxhunt-ci/foxhunt-training-runtime:latest command: ["/binaries/$(TRAINING_BINARY)"] volumeMounts: - name: binaries mountPath: /binaries readOnly: true ``` ### Cache PVCs 8 PVCs, one per service deployment (500Mi each, scw-bssd): ```yaml apiVersion: v1 kind: PersistentVolumeClaim metadata: name: binary-cache-trading-service namespace: foxhunt spec: accessModes: [ReadWriteOnce] resources: requests: storage: 500Mi storageClassName: scw-bssd ``` Total: 8 × 500Mi = 4Gi. Cost: ~€0.08/month. ### Resilience During Trading 1. **Running pods unaffected**: Binaries live in emptyDir for the pod's lifetime. S3 outage has zero impact on running services. 2. **Pod crash + S3 down**: initContainer falls back to PVC cache (last known good binary). 3. **Pod crash + S3 down + empty cache**: Only on first-ever deploy. Pod stays in Init:Error; deployment's `maxUnavailable: 0` prevents the old pod from terminating. 4. **Deployment strategy**: `maxSurge: 1, maxUnavailable: 0` ensures old pod keeps running until new pod is ready. ### What Gets Deleted | Item | Notes | |------|-------| | `Dockerfile.runtime` | Replaced by `foxhunt-runtime` | | `Dockerfile.training` | Replaced by `foxhunt-training-runtime` | | `Dockerfile.web-gateway-runtime` | Replaced by `foxhunt-runtime` + initContainer | | `Dockerfile.web-gateway` | Full multi-stage builder, no longer needed | | `Dockerfile.service` | Full multi-stage builder, no longer needed | | 9 Kaniko CI jobs | All `build-*` jobs in `.gitlab-ci.yml` | | 10 per-service Docker images | In Scaleway CR and GitLab registry | ### What's Kept | Item | Notes | |------|-------| | `Dockerfile.ci-builder` | Compile infrastructure, unchanged | | `Dockerfile.ci-builder-cpu` | Compile infrastructure, unchanged | | `Dockerfile.infra-runner` | IaC pipeline, unchanged | | Image-prepuller DaemonSet | Updated to pull `foxhunt-training-runtime` | ### Timing Comparison | Step | Before | After | |------|--------|-------| | Compile | 8-22 min | 8-22 min (unchanged) | | Image build | 2-5 min (9 Kaniko) | 0 (eliminated) | | Registry push | 1-2 min | ~10s (S3 upload) | | Pod startup | 30s-3min (image pull) | 2-5s (initContainer S3 fetch) | | Total pipeline | 15-30 min | 8-23 min | | Pod restart | 30s-3min | 2-5s | ### New Infrastructure | Resource | Spec | Cost | |----------|------|------| | S3 bucket `foxhunt-binaries` | fr-par, 30-day lifecycle | ~€0.01/month | | 8 cache PVCs (500Mi each) | scw-bssd | ~€0.08/month | | 3 base image Dockerfiles | In `infra/docker/` | 0 | ### rclone Configuration rclone in CI and pods is configured via environment variables (no config file needed): ``` RCLONE_S3_PROVIDER=Scaleway RCLONE_S3_ENDPOINT=s3.fr-par.scw.cloud RCLONE_S3_REGION=fr-par RCLONE_S3_ACCESS_KEY_ID= RCLONE_S3_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Y= ``` The `s3-credentials` K8s secret already exists in the foxhunt namespace (used by training_uploader).
